High school econ ......
My multi-bagger old flame vs new found love
WFCF(2016):
Current price $2.25(mc $55 million)
Revenue 11.6 million
Net income 433k
eps 2c
shares 23.8 million
cash&investment $3.22
pe=99.56 as of today,http://www.marketwatch.com/investing/stock/wfcf
CEO John Saunders is beloved by everyone and 100% accessible except the company is stalled in topline.
vs
ivfh(2016):
Current price 57cents(mc $17 million)
Revenue 35 million
Net income $1.9 million(included a 875k write-off of discontinued operation)
eps 8c
shares 29.98 million as of 5/10/2017
cash&investment $3.76
pe=6 (included a 875k write-off)
CEO sucks and the company topline is growing leaps and bounds.
or
Both companies are alike in term of fundament/cash position/.........
Except ivfh shortfalls:
"Shareholders continue to receive their regular dividends ($0). They continue to have no say in the company. The company returns zero phone calls from investors."

I believe the "DEEP DISCOUNT" priced into the ivfh stock is LUNACY AND OVER DONE. I am betting this "DEEP DISCOUNT" premium would decay over time,and I am assuming status quo.
